Where Does MSM for Dogs Come From?
MSM can be sourced through two primary methods: naturally occurring or synthetic.
- Naturally Occurring MSM: When phytoplankton in the ocean decompose, they release dimethylsulfide (DMS). This DMS then reacts with oxygen and sunlight to form MSM and other sulfates. In nature, MSM is absorbed by clouds and distributed to plants through rainfall.
- Synthetic MSM: For commercial use, MSM is synthesized through a catalytic reaction involving dimethylsulfoxide (DMSO) and hydrogen peroxide. DMSO is often a byproduct of wood pulping. It’s important to note that medical-grade DMSO is used in the production of MSM supplements, ensuring safety and quality.
While the natural production of MSM is vital for aquatic ecosystems, directly harvesting it from phytoplankton is not feasible for supplement production. Therefore, manufacturing processes like the DMSO creation method are employed to produce MSM for commercial use.

MSM for Dogs Allergies
MSM can offer relief from allergies in dogs, in addition to alleviating joint pain. This is because MSM naturally obstructs allergens from accessing the host by forming a protective mucous layer. Furthermore, MSM possesses detoxification and antioxidant properties that help eliminate free radicals in the dog’s body, thereby reducing the likelihood of allergic reactions.

1. Decreases Pain Associated With Joint Diseases or Ailments
As a natural anti-inflammatory, MSM supplements can significantly improve the comfort of dogs suffering from arthritis and general joint pain. In some cases, MSM alone may be sufficient to manage pain, negating the need for NSAIDs and their potential side effects.
Even if your dog still requires NSAIDs for pain management, MSM can be safely used in conjunction with them. Combining MSM and NSAIDs may even allow for a reduction in NSAID dosage over time, further minimizing the risk of side effects.
2. Acts as a Powerful Antioxidant
MSM activates transcription factors, which are specialized proteins involved in immune system responses. These factors help regulate and balance antioxidant enzymes, ensuring the stability of your dog’s cells. Think of transcription factors as vigilant guardians ensuring all cells function correctly and remain healthy.
MSM also has the ability to bind to and inhibit free radicals. Free radicals are unstable atoms that can damage cells, leading to illness and premature aging.

How Much MSM for Dogs?
Given the numerous benefits of MSM for dogs, a common question is about the appropriate dosage. It’s crucial to administer the correct amount to avoid any potential negative side effects from a supplement intended to improve your dog’s well-being.
Similar to other supplements, the dosage of MSM for dogs is typically determined by their weight. Here’s a general guideline for appropriate MSM dosages based on weight:
| Dog Weight | MSM Daily Dosage |
|---|---|
| Less than 10 pounds (approx. 4.5kg) | Less than 500mg |
| 11–20 pounds (4.5–9kg) | 500mg |
| More than 20 pounds (over 9kg) | Add 500 mg for every 10lbs (e.g., a 40lb dog would receive 1,000 mg of MSM) |
Can Your Dog Get Too Much MSM?
Fortunately, MSM is not only effective but also exceptionally safe. While some dogs might experience mild side effects like diarrhea, lethargy, restlessness, or loss of appetite, the vast majority tolerate MSM without any adverse reactions.
In fact, MSM has a toxicity level comparable to water. However, if an excessive amount is given, your dog might experience gastrointestinal discomfort, such as diarrhea, bloating, and nausea. While an overdose is unlikely, adhering to the recommended dosage for your dog’s size is still advisable to prevent any potential issues.

In addition to checking product reviews and GMP compliance, it’s essential to examine the ingredient list of any MSM for dogs supplement.
Reading a supplement label might seem straightforward, but manufacturers often use different formatting and fonts, making ingredient identification challenging. Comparing labels can be a tedious process.
When reviewing supplement labels, keep these three tips in mind:
- Compare Active vs. Inactive Ingredients: Active ingredients are those that provide a therapeutic benefit, while inactive ingredients include fillers, flavorings, and preservatives. Prioritize supplements that emphasize active ingredients.
- Serving Sizes: A high proportion of inactive ingredients can increase the serving size needed to achieve an effective dosage. This means you’ll need to repurchase the supplement more frequently and increases the chance of your dog rejecting it. Supplements with fewer inactive ingredients usually have smaller serving sizes and are easier to administer.
- Designations: Certifications like GMP and being a recognized Veterinary Health Product by Health Canada or other regulatory bodies are strong indicators of quality and trustworthiness.
